The Story
Plant Bio
Hosta x hybrida 'Peter Pan' is a compact perennial with lush, broad, heart-shaped leaves and tall flower spikes bearing lavender to pale purple bell-shaped flowers. This cultivar is prized for its small, dense growth habit and its striking foliage, which maintains a vibrant green color with a slightly rippled margin throughout the season.

Planting
How to Grow
- Tuck seeds or divisions into shaded soil in early spring.
- Water thoroughly after planting to settle soil.
- Mulch around base to retain moisture and suppress weeds.
- Fertilize with a balanced, slow-release fertilizer in spring.
- Divide clumps every 3–4 years in early spring or fall.
- Mist foliage during dry spells to prevent stress.
Pro Tip
Plant in shaded areas with well-draining, humus-rich soil for best results.
Keep It Thriving
Care Guide
Do
- Water regularly to keep soil moist 🌱
- Mulch to retain moisture and regulate temperature
- Remove dead or damaged leaves in early spring
Don't
- Avoid direct sunlight which can scorch leaves ❌
- Don’t let soil dry out completely
- Avoid heavy, compacted soils that hinder root growth

Common Questions
Hosta Peter Pan questions
What zones can Hosta Peter Pan grow in?
Hosta Peter Pan is hardy in USDA Zones 4–9. Inside that range it survives winter in the ground; outside it, grow it as an annual or a container plant you protect.
Is Hosta Peter Pan deer resistant?
Not reliably. Deer may browse Hosta Peter Pan, especially tender spring growth — plan on repellents or fencing where pressure is high.
When does Hosta Peter Pan bloom?
Hosta Peter Pan typically blooms in mid-summer through late summer. Exact timing shifts a week or two with your zone — Sow's bloom calendar maps it to your garden.
Does Hosta Peter Pan need full sun?
Hosta Peter Pan does best in part shade.
